About Me

As a Licensed Independent Clinical Social Worker (LICSW), I am licensed by the Commonwealth of Massachusetts to practice psychotherapy and provide clinical social work services. I am also theologically trained and attended both theological school and social work school at Boston University. I have extensive post-masters experience in working in mental health as well as medical healthcare, and I completed a post-graduate fellowship in psychoanalysis at the Massachusetts Institute for Psychoanalysis. My primary expertise comes from engaging in a healing practice with my clients and helping them through what is often the most difficult experiences in their life.

I specialize in helping people through loss ... be it loss of functionality or ability, loss of a sense of peace, loss of employment, loss of how a relationship used to be, or the loss of a person. I work with adolescents, adults, couples, and families, and utilize my theological and clinical social work training toward healing and positive change. My style adapts to the unique needs of the client, including psychodynamic psychotherapy, cognitive behavioral therapy, mindfulness-based stress reduction, spiritual counseling, and motivational interviewing.

In addition to my psychotherapeutic practice, I serve on the Board and Executive Committee of the National Association of Social Workers, Massachusetts (NASW-MA) and Co-Chair the Mental Health and Substance Abuse Committee of NASW-MA. I also provide educational presentations for schools and colleges on grief and loss counseling, spirituality and mental health, and mindfulness.
